Cossus hoenei

Cossus hoenei is a moth in the family Cossidae. It is found in China (Shaanxi).

The length of the forewings is about 22 mm. The forewings are grey-brown with a wavy pattern and a small light-grey field in the discal area. The hindwings are grey with a reticulate pattern.

Etymology

The species is named in honour of Dr H. Höne.[1]
